Gaspar (or Caspar), Melchior and Balthasar, three kings from the east, are stated to have traveled a long solution to see Baby Jesus, following a freakishly massive, brilliant star and hauling gifts of gold, frankincense and myrrh along with them. The mosaic, housed within the Basilica di Sant'Apollinare Nuovo in Ravenna, Italy, incorporates the names Gaspar, Melchior and Balthasar.
The parable of their names emerged later, after a mosaic depicting the magi was created within the sixth century. And the variety of and names of the magi are by no means detailed anywhere in writing. But magi are clever men, not kings. The Bible says magi came from the east, following a big star, and that they had been on the lookout for the King of the Jews. Yet some individuals around the globe, namely Christians from European countries where St. Nick was a beloved hero, still have fun St. Nicholas Day on Dec. 6 by setting out sneakers or hanging stockings the night time earlier than. Lots of people have never heard of Boxing Day. Boxing Day is Dec. 26, and it is a celebration that takes place solely in just a few nations. Nicholas died on Dec. 6, and was eventually proclaimed a saint. St. Nicholas was a fourth-century Turkish bishop who spent his life giving money to the poor, and it's said one of his favored strategies was secretly leaving cash in people's stockings in a single day. Thus, Dec. 6 grew to become known as St. Nicholas Day. In Germany, as in lots of European nations, St. Nick historically delivers his gifts on the night time of Dec. 5, not on Christmas Eve. Father Christmas and Kris Kringle usually brought gifts on Christmas, not Dec. 6. When Dutch settlers began emigrating to the U.S., they brought with them stories of St. Nicholas, whom they referred to as Sinterklaas. In the U.S., St. Nick became Kris Kringle.
